Output 51c0b422bb61302713c188ecbfc925178f809a01a9c397bcdab804d625d5e8ae:5
- value
- 680000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89034e894bb5882c6f45f7aa46dbbc6e73ad05eb OP_EQUAL
- address
- 3EBUTap95JRhzXxs97mYLuCLFX3M43UaV9
- transaction
- 51c0b422bb61302713c188ecbfc925178f809a01a9c397bcdab804d625d5e8ae
- spent
- true